Career path
| Zero Waste Event Management Career Roles (UK) | Description |
|---|---|
| Sustainability Event Planner | Develops and implements sustainable strategies for events, minimizing waste and environmental impact. High demand due to growing corporate social responsibility. |
| Zero Waste Consultant (Events) | Advises event organizers on waste reduction techniques, recycling programs, and compost strategies. Expertise in waste audits and sustainable procurement. |
| Circular Economy Event Manager | Focuses on designing events within a circular economy framework, prioritizing reuse, repair, and repurposing of resources. Emerging role with high future potential. |
| Green Event Logistics Coordinator | Manages event logistics with a focus on minimizing transportation emissions and waste generation during event setup, execution, and breakdown. |
| Sustainable Event Marketing Specialist | Develops marketing campaigns that promote the event's sustainability initiatives and attract environmentally conscious attendees. Growing demand for transparency. |
